Sourland Mountain Spirits Vodka

This is a seriously silky smooth craft Vodka.

Sourland Mountain Spirits are located on a beautiful sustainable farm in the Sourland Mountains of Hopewell, New Jersey. There, the Dische family is building a real community of Spirit lovers that value meaningful experiences. Well, we can definitely relate to that! Focusing on craft Spirits and grain-to-glass production, they say they pour their family’s heart into every unique and tasty bottle they produce.

We love Sourland Mountain Spirits Vodka because this one is seriously silky smooth from start to finish. Crafted with 100% organic corn and distilled 6 times, this craft Vodka is made with the purest fresh water from the aquifer in the Sourland Mountains. It’s clean and crisp with a slight sweetness coming through in the end. This one can really be enjoyed any way you like and it already won two Bronze Medals, one from American Distilling Institute in 2018 and the other at the 2017 New York Spirits Competition.
